검체채취실의 고객만족도 향상 (Improvement for the Degree of Client Satisfaction in the Sample Collection Room)

  • 박연보;강희정;권흥만;안상진;양석환;태연주;진영희;조현구;이복자;구선회
    • 대한임상검사과학회지
    • /
    • 제36권2호
    • /
    • pp.222-232
    • /
    • 2004
  • The sample collection room(SCR) will have much more influence than all the other departments for the improvement of hospital image, if anyone coming to the SCR in the hospital goes back with the perfect complacency and because most clients who have much stresses and fatigues pay a final visit to the SCR via receipt-diagnosis- acceptance process. SCR has improved its image for the purpose of gratifying clients, in order for clients to visit the hospital again, the quality improvement(QI) team in the Diagnosis Inspection Medical Department has come to a conclusion as follows. The degree of client gratification before improvement marks 65.9 point, but the degree after improvement was 74.2 point. Therefore, satisfaction has increased by 8.3 points. The degree of client gratification in groups before improvement marks (1) service parts-89.2 points (2) facilities and environments-49.1 point (3) toilet facilities-46.3 point. But its gratification after improvement marks (1) 92.5 point (2) 60.1 point (3) 61.0 point. Therefore the degree of satisfaction has increased by (1) 3.3 point, (2) 11.0 point, (3) 14.7 point. The progress of facility improvement plans and the exclusion of improvement on the facility contents in the hospital have made facilities and environments of SCR and toilet facilities to be poorly improved. Although service parts have a good mark, and the facilities and environments are not scoring well, the whole degree clients' gratification of SCR couldn't be helped by the low grade. Therefore the bottom line for the clients' gratification of SCR in the future is to ameliorate the facilities and environments. SCR will take the clients' gratification survey every year and if any items get low marks, that is, below 90 point throughout the survey, SCR will immediately starts the improvement work for the clients' gratification with operating the programs of controlling quality continually, and SCR should induce the operation of services, participating in the kind campaign drive for clients. So SCR will adopt the incentive system for the best staff members who perform these kinds of services.

호스피스 완화의료 전문인력의 죽음에 대한 태도가 임종돌봄 스트레스에 미치는 영향 (The Effects of Attitude to Death in the Hospice and Palliative Professionals on Their Terminal Care Stress)

  • 목적: 본 연구는 호스피스 완화의료 전문인력의 죽음에 대한 태도의 임종 돌봄 스트레스에 대한 효과를 탐구하고, 이 두 변수와 관련된 우울, 대처전략들의 변수와의 상관관계를 분석하기 위해 시도되었다. 방법: 연구 대상자는 호스피스 완화의료 전문인력 131명이며, J도를 중심으로 2개의 상급종합병원과 2개의 종합병원 암병동, 2개의 호스피스 시설, 2개의 전문요양병원 및 2개의 노인병원에서 실시되었다. 자료는 2015년 3월부터 6월에 수집되었으며, 자료 분석에는 SPSS/WIN 21.0과 AMOS 18.0 programs을 사용하였고, t-test, factor analysis, ANOVA ($Scheff{\acute{e}}$), Pearson's correlation 및 path analysis를 실시하였다. 결과: 죽음에 대한 태도는 낮았으며(2.63점), 우울 점수는 0.45점이였으나 15.0%의 대상자는 우울관리가 요구되었다. 임종 돌봄 스트레스가 높고(3.82점), 그 중 의료 한계에 대한 갈등이 가장 높았다(4.04점). 스트레스 대처는 낮았으며(3.13점), 대인관계 기피(4.03점), 간식이나 잠을 취하는 기본욕구 충족(3.65점)과 같은 소극적인 방법을 사용하였다. 죽음에 대한 태도는 임종 돌봄 스트레스에 직접적으로 부적 영향을 주었으며, 우울과 기본 욕구 충족(CS2)을 통한 간접적인 영향을 주었다. 결론: 호스피스 완화의료 전문인력들에게 죽음에 대한 태도를 향상시키고 효과적인 대처전략을 활용하게 하는 인지적 지지와 정서적 지지를 제공하는 프로그램 제공이 요구된다.

Studies on the Preparation of Organic Compounds Labelled by $^{38}Cl$.(I) - Inorganic Yields of $^{38}$ Cl in Szilard Chalmer Reaction of Aromatic Chloro Derivatives

  • 방사성 $^{38}$ CL로 표지된 유기 하로겐 화합물의 제조방법을 가려내기 위하여서 Phenyl halides(7종), thloro nitrobenzene(6종), Chloro nitroanisole(2종), Chloro aniline (3종), Chloro anisidine(3종), Chloro toluene(3종), Benzyl chloride 유도체(4종) 및 기타 대조 화합물 3종 등을 원자로 내에서 조사하고 생성물을 알카리 수용액으로 주출하고 각각의 무기 $^{38}$ CL 수율을 조사시간 별로 검토하였다. 그 결과 화합물의 구조 보다도 표적물의 상태에 따라서 무기물 수율에 변화가 있고 고체상의 표적물의 경우에는 수율이 일반적으로 얕고 변화가 고르다는 것을 화인 하였다. 화학구조에 따르는 무기 $^{38}$ CL0의 생성수율의 감소는 현재까지의 결과로 보아서 Phenyl chlorides$^{38}$ CL 수율간에 Linear relationship가 있었으며 염소원자수가 많을수록 그 수율이 얕았다. 실험 결과를 논의하였으며 교지 반응에 대한 본 실험 결과의 응용성가능 여부를 고찰하였다.

울진 봉평리 신라비의 재판독과 보존과학적 진단 (Reconsideration and Conservational Scientific Diagnosis of Silla Stone Monument in Bongpyeong-ri, Uljin)

  • 이 연구에서는 울진 봉평리 신라비를 대상으로 비문에 대한 인문학적 조사와 손상도에 대한 보존과학적 진단을 융합하여 역사적 가치의 재인식과 원형유지를 위한 보존방안을 수립하였다. 먼저 봉평비의 비문을 재판독한 결과, I행 마지막 글자는 오(五)자로 재확인하였으며, 선행연구와 다르게 판독된 글자는 모두 13자로 조사되어 이를 통해 기존 판독문의 의미와 해석이 일부 달라졌다. 봉평비의 구성암석은 편마상 우백질화강암으로 이 암석의 산지로 가장 유력한 지점은 색, 광물의 입도와 조성, 편마상 구조, 자화강도 등이 거의 유사한 죽변 해변 일대(2.1km)로 판명되었다. 봉평비는 편마상 구조를 따라 구조상(균열지수: 0.4) 및 미세 균열(균열지수: 2.0)이 발달하여 수평방향의 물성이 수직방향에 비해 취약하므로 균열계의 보강과 처리가 필요하다. 그러나 초음파 측정에 따른 전체 풍화등급은 3등급(3,404m/s, 0.32)의 중간 풍화단계를 나타내는 것으로 보아 강화처리가 시급한 단계는 아니다. 또한 화학적 손상은 토양, 철산화물 및 탁본흔적에 의한 흑화현상(85.2%)과 바다로부터 전이된 NaCl 염결정(17.3%)이 주요 문제점으로 나타났다. 따라서 오염물과 염결정은 일차적으로 증류수 압력 분무법과 펄프종이를 이용하여 제거하고, 임상실험을 통해 습포제 적용을 검토해야 한다.

PRESENT DAY EOPS AND SAMG - WHERE DO WE GO FROM HERE?

  • The Fukushima-Daiichi accident shook the world, as a well-known plant design, the General Electric BWR Mark I, was heavily damaged in the tsunami, which followed the Great Japanese Earthquake of 11 March 2011. Plant safety functions were lost and, as both AC and DC failed, manoeuvrability of the plants at the site virtually came to a full stop. The traditional system of Emergency Operating Procedures (EOPs) and Severe Accident Management Guidelines (SAMG) failed to protect core and containment, and severe core damage resulted, followed by devastating hydrogen explosions and, finally, considerable radioactive releases. The root cause may not only have been that the design against tsunamis was incorrect, but that the defence against accidents in most power plants is based on traditional assumptions, such as Large Break LOCA as the limiting event, whereas there is no engineered design against severe accidents in most plants. Accidents beyond the licensed design basis have hardly been considered in the various designs, and if they were included, they often were not classified for their safety role, as most system safety classifications considered only design basis accidents. It is, hence, time to again consider the Design Basis Accident, and ask ourselves whether the time has not come to consider engineered safety functions to mitigate core damage accidents. Associated is a proper classification of those systems that do the job. Also associated are safety criteria, which so far are only related to 'public health and safety'; in reality, nuclear accidents cause few casualties, but create immense economical and societal effects-for which there are no criteria to be met. Severe accidents create an environment far surpassing the imagination of those who developed EOPs and SAMG, most of which was developed after Three Mile Island - an accident where all was still in place, except the insight in the event was lost. It requires fundamental changes in our present safety approach and safety thinking and, hence, also in our EOPs and SAMG, in order to prevent future 'Fukushimas'.

섬강에 서식하는 멸종위기종 꾸구리 Gobiobotia macrocephala(Pisces: Cyprinidae)의 서식개체수 추정 (Population Estimates of the Endangered Species, Gobiobotia macrocephala (Pisces: Cyprinidae) in Seom River, Korea)

  • 섬강에 서식하는 꾸구리의 서식개체수를 추정하기 위하여 2010년 9월부터 10월까지 강원도 원주시 섬강 일대에서 조사를 실시하였다. 꾸구리가 출현한 곳은 14개 지점이었으며, 자갈과 돌이 깔린 하류의 여울부에서 주로 서식하고 있었다. 출현개체수가 가장 많고 서식지가 안정된 두 개 지점에서 표지-재포획법과 방형구(족대조사와 수중관찰)를 이용하여 서식개체수를 추정한 결과 표지-재포획법으로 $8,295{\pm}4,922$개체와 $39,846{\pm}14,232$개체로 각각 추정되었고, 방형구의 족대조사는 9,216개체와 37,873개체로, 수중관찰은 5,593개체와 24,347개체로 추정되었다.

Participation in G-CLEF Preliminary Design Study by KASI

  • The GMT-Consortium Large Earth Finder (G-CLEF) is a fiber-fed, optical band high dispersion echelle spectrograph that selected as the first light instrument for the Giant Magellan Telescope (GMT). This G-CLEF has been designed to be a general- purpose echelle spectrograph with the precisional radial velocity (PRV) capability of 10 cm/sec as a goal. The preliminary design review (PDR) was held on April 8 to 10, 2015 and the scientific observations will be started in 2022 with four mirrors installed on GMT. We have been participating in this preliminary design study in flexure control camera (slit monitoring system), calibration lamp sources, dichroic assembly and the fabrication of the proto-Mangin Mirror. We present the design concept on the parts KASI undertaken, introducing the specifications and capabilities of G-CLEF.

일본의 금융분야 ADR 에 관한 검토 (On the Japanese New Alternative Dispute Resolution System in the Financial Sector)

  • In the past, ADR has not been used as frequently in Japan as it has in other parts of the industrialized world. However, though litigation is still the most utilized vehicle of dispute resolution by Japanese financial institutions, this will be changing. The New Financial ADR system, which was created by a June 2009 amendment to the Financial Instruments and Exchange Act, is meant to deal with every stage of financial-related disputes and, as such, strives to resolve disputes before they become significant and acts to ameliorate any post-ADR issues that may remain, thereby completing the FIEA's purpose to protect investors. Since the foundation of the New Financial ADR system applies to all related industries, new provisions were set out in 16 business related acts, such as the Banking Act, the Insurance Business Act, and FIEA itself. October 2010 will mark the formal introduction of a new system of financial ADR in Japan. New Financial ADR in Japan will be modeled on the Financial Ombudsman Service in the United Kingdom, but will not feature one comprehensive dispute resolution system in which one dispute resolution institution covers all disputes in the financial field. The New Financial ADR system is merely one step towards a foundation of comprehensive financial ADR such as FOS. It must be noted, however, that this all important first step was over seven years in the making, involving a great deal of discussion, debate, and compromise amongst many parts of Japanese government, business, and society. The New Financial ADR system grants participating parties the ability to stop the clock on any statute of limitations which may correspond to any future possible court cases related to the dispute,13 and further grants the ability to suspend related court proceedings while the parties are utilizing the New Financial ADR system. In addition, where financial institutions have not accepted dispute resolution proceedings or have not accepted a special conciliation proposal, the Ministry of Finance may issue an order compelling compliance if it is found that certain actions are necessary to ensure the appropriate operations of a financial institution's business. Initial Experience with Epicardial Ultrasound Scanning in Coronary Artery Bypass Grafting

  • Background: The benefits of epicardial ultrasound scanning (EUS) in coronary artery bypass grafting (CABG) have not yet been established. The aim of this study was to evaluate the usefulness of EUS in CABG, including in the assessment of the quality of distal anastomoses, the identification of epicardial target vessels, and the evaluation of any graft issues other than the distal anastomoses. Methods: Fifty-three patients undergoing CABG were enrolled between March 2018 and February 2019. Intraoperative EUS was performed along with transit-time flow measurement (TTFM). Graft evaluations were performed early (shortly after surgery) and 1 year after surgery for 53 (100%) and 47 (88.7%) patients, respectively. Results: EUS was applied to assess the quality of all distal anastomoses, 32 target vessels, and 2 conduit trunks. Insufficient TTFM findings were obtained for 18 grafts. However, graft revision was performed for only 3 distal anastomoses; based on the EUS findings, the remaining 15 sites were not revised. The early and 1-year overall graft patency rates were 100% (141 anastomoses) and 96.1% (122 of 127 anastomoses), respectively. All 15 of the distal anastomoses that were not revised despite insufficient TTFM results were patent at the 1-year mark. Conclusion: The routine application of EUS in CABG could be beneficial by confirming the quality of surgery and reducing unnecessary procedures.

Impact on Retrievability by Cement Variety for Implant Restorations Equipped with a Lingual Slot

  • Purpose: The purpose of this study is to measure and compare the removal torques of different cements applied in attachments of zirconia restorations on titanium (Ti) abutments fitted with retrievable cement-type slot (RCS) on the lingual side for the better retrievablity by use of a slot driver. Materials and Methods: Three types of cements were used in the experiment: two permanent cements in $RelyX^{TM}$ U200 (RU) (3M ESPE) which is a resin cement and $FujiCem^{TM}$ (FC) (GC) which is a resin-modified glass ionomer cement, and a temporary cement in $Freegenol^{TM}$ temporary cement (TC) (GC). Measurements of removal torques were conducted as follows; an attached sample was fixed on the equipment customized for the experiment; a slot driver was connected to a MGT12 (Mark-10 Corp.), a torque measurement instrument; the sample had the driver fitted to its RCS and then was rotated until the it was removed; and finally, the maximum torque value was recorded. Result: As for the removal torque measurement results, the average values were $47.9{\pm}2.6Ncm$ for RU, $43.4{\pm}1.5Ncm$ for FC, and $20.9{\pm}1.0Ncm$ for TC. The statistical analysis using Kruskal-Wallis test yielded the significance probability of P<0.05 (P=0.002), which confirmed the presence of significant differences between the three groups. Conclusion: All three cements exhibit clinically acceptable levels of removal torque when applied to an upper zirconia implant restoration fitted with a lingual slot, with RU and FC, the two permanent cements, having the significantly higher values than that of TC, the temporary cement.
